Capturing Callie
by Avery Gale
Callie Reece has always been the responsible one…and where has it gotten her? A low-paying job as a reporter sent out under the cover of darkness in a rowboat to spy on the ultra-exclusive BDSM club that caters to Washington’s inner circle.
Club owner Ian McGregor and his best friend, former Navy SEAL Jace Garrett, capture the tiny blonde beauty trying to sneak on the island. Ian is captivated by the woman he sees below the surface, and he recognizes Callie as a submissive from the moment he looks into her eyes—eyes filled with innocence and curiosity. Ian gives her a choice—jail or a month as his submissive. Is she brave enough to pursue a lifestyle she’d already become interested in?
But, nothing is ever as easy as it should be with the little cat burglar. Callie is the last witness to a crime committed by the only son of United States Senator John Westmore. Grant Westmore is seeking a powerful State Department appointment and Callie is the last loose end standing in his way. Can Ian McGregor’s billions keep Callie safe?

Martial Peak Reviews
Capturing Callie by Avery Gale is a captivating exploration of desire, power dynamics, and the complexities of human relationships set against the backdrop of a clandestine BDSM club. The novel introduces us to Callie Reece, a responsible reporter whose life takes an unexpected turn when she finds herself caught in a web of intrigue and seduction. Gale's narrative deftly balances elements of romance, suspense, and self-discovery, making it a compelling read for fans of contemporary erotic fiction.
At the heart of the story is Callie, a character who embodies the struggle between societal expectations and personal desires. As a reporter, she has always played by the rules, but her assignment to investigate an exclusive BDSM club reveals her hidden curiosity about a lifestyle that challenges her notions of control and submission. Callie's character development is profound; she transitions from a cautious observer to an active participant in her own narrative. This evolution is not just about her exploration of BDSM but also about her reclaiming her agency and understanding her own desires.
Ian McGregor, the enigmatic owner of the BDSM club, serves as both a mentor and a catalyst for Callie's transformation. From their first encounter, Ian recognizes the submissive nature within Callie, and his offer of a choice—jail or a month as his submissive—sets the stage for a complex power exchange. Ian is portrayed as a dominant figure, yet Gale ensures that his character is multi-dimensional. He is not merely a man of wealth and power; he is also deeply empathetic and protective, particularly when it comes to Callie's safety. This duality adds depth to their relationship, as it navigates the fine line between dominance and care.
The chemistry between Callie and Ian is palpable, and Gale skillfully builds tension throughout the narrative. Their interactions are charged with a mix of vulnerability and strength, showcasing the intricacies of BDSM relationships. The author does not shy away from depicting the emotional and psychological aspects of submission and dominance, making it clear that consent and trust are paramount in their dynamic. This focus on the emotional landscape of BDSM sets Capturing Callie apart from other works in the genre, where the physical aspects often overshadow the psychological nuances.
Another significant character in the story is Jace Garrett, Ian's best friend and a former Navy SEAL. Jace adds an additional layer of complexity to the narrative, serving as a foil to Ian. While Ian embodies the world of BDSM, Jace represents a more traditional view of masculinity and protection. His character introduces themes of loyalty and friendship, as he grapples with his feelings for Callie and his commitment to Ian. The interplay between these three characters creates a rich tapestry of relationships that keeps readers engaged and invested in their fates.
The plot thickens when Callie becomes entangled in a dangerous situation involving Grant Westmore, the son of a powerful senator. This subplot introduces elements of suspense and danger, heightening the stakes for Callie and Ian. Gale expertly weaves this tension into the narrative, ensuring that the reader is not only invested in the romantic aspects but also in the overarching conflict that threatens Callie's safety. The juxtaposition of the erotic and the perilous creates a thrilling reading experience, as the characters navigate their desires while confronting external threats.
Thematically, Capturing Callie delves into the notions of freedom and restraint, both in the context of BDSM and in the characters' personal lives. Callie's journey is one of self-discovery, as she learns to embrace her desires and challenge the constraints that society has placed upon her. The novel raises important questions about the nature of power and submission, emphasizing that true strength often lies in vulnerability and trust. Gale's portrayal of BDSM is respectful and nuanced, highlighting the importance of communication and consent in any relationship.
In comparison to other works in the genre, such as E.L. James's Fifty Shades of Grey or Sylvia Day's Crossfire series, Gale's approach feels more grounded and authentic. While those stories often focus on the fantasy elements of BDSM, Capturing Callie provides a more realistic depiction of the emotional and psychological complexities involved. Gale's writing is both evocative and insightful, allowing readers to connect with the characters on a deeper level.
Overall, Capturing Callie is a well-crafted narrative that successfully blends romance, suspense, and exploration of BDSM culture. Avery Gale's ability to create relatable characters and a gripping plot makes this novel a standout in contemporary erotic fiction. Readers will find themselves drawn into Callie's world, rooting for her as she navigates the challenges of love, desire, and danger. With its rich character development and thought-provoking themes, Capturing Callie is a must-read for anyone interested in the complexities of human relationships and the power of self-discovery.
